How does Natural Gas get to your home?

A very good question and one that deserves a good answer. Just like electricity, natural gas is supplied to most peoples homes in the UK. Natural gas is very important to many people it heats their home and enables them to cook their food, and have a hot shower!

How?

Natural gas companies drill thousands of feet into the earth and use big wells and pumps to bring it to the surface.

Then they send the gas to your town through gas mains buried underground. Utility companies bring it to your house in smaller pipes.

Those pipes connect to the meter outside your house, which measures how much natural gas your family uses.

More pipes connect the meter to the gas appliances you use at home, like the boiler, water heater, gas fire or cooker.
